Course Overview
This course is a hands-on learning experience designed to provide an actionable set of steps to help your organizations implement a Cloud Financial Operations (FinOps) strategy to maximize your cloud investment with Google Cloud. This course is suitable for Finance and/or IT related roles responsible for optimizing organization's cloud cost.
Prerequisites
Completion of the Google Cloud Fundamentals: Core Infrastructure (GCF-CI) course or equivalent experience with Google Cloud.
Course Objectives
- Describe Cloud FinOps
 - Apply FinOps Cultural Principles
 - Explain the Cloud FinOps Framework
 - Manage and implement Cloud cost processes
 - Monitor spend and build Cloud cost reports
 - Create Forecasts in Google Cloud
